I am a PhD student in economics at VU Amsterdam and the Tinbergen Institute. I consider myself an applied economist and work in industrial organization, the economics of innovation, applied microeconomics, and applied econometrics, combining applied theory and applied econometrics. My supervisors are Sabien Dobbelaere and Jose Luis Moraga-Gonzalez. In May-June 2026 I visited CUNEF Universidad Madrid at the invitation of Costanza Cincotta. In the first half of 2023 I visited Penn State’s economics department at the invitation of Mark J. Roberts.

I am currently interested in how and why firms allocate their research: the mode of that research, why firms enter certain areas, and how changes in market structure affect the scale and composition of their research.
